Hi, I have a reproducible bug with versions 174 and 176 (at least). A db created with 1.3.174 (no particular settings) corrupts when just opening and closing it in 1.3.176. To reproduce:
1. download this sql (generated by the SCRIPT command from a test db of mine): https://www.dropbox.com/s/gjng7vfqkpp9fio/SQL.sql 2. create a blank db in 1.3.174 and restore the script; close the db 3. open the db in 1.3.176, close it; 4. reopen the db in 1.3.176. it will crash. As said, I don't use any parameter for the JDBC URL. The crash is this: Exception in thread "main" org.h2.jdbc.JdbcSQLException: Unique index or primary key violation: "PRIMARY KEY ON """".PAGE_INDEX"; SQL statement: ALTER TABLE PUBLIC.DETAILS ADD CONSTRAINT PUBLIC.FK_DETAILS FOREIGN KEY(ID) REFERENCES PUBLIC.ENTITIES(ID) NOCHECK [23505-176] at org.h2.message.DbException.getJdbcSQLException(DbException.java:344) at org.h2.message.DbException.get(DbException.java:178) at org.h2.message.DbException.get(DbException.java:154) at org.h2.index.PageDataIndex.getNewDuplicateKeyException(PageDataIndex.java:166) at org.h2.index.PageDataIndex.add(PageDataIndex.java:144) at org.h2.store.PageStore.addMeta(PageStore.java:1808) ...
